Job Details
Are you an early career researcher looking for your first challenge?
Do you have a background in blood coagulation?
Do you want to further your career in one of the UK's leading research intensive Universities?
You will be working in a team, under the supervision of senior staff. This post will be primarily contributing towards the characterisation of small molecules and how they interfere in blood clot formation and fibrinolysis using a varied number of purified, plasma and whole blood based methodologies, including thrombin generation techniques, fibrin clot formation and lysis including turbidimetric assays, laser scanning confocal microscopy, scanning electron microscopy, and ROTEM. You will be a member of a multidisciplinary team working towards novel drug discovery.
